KATHMANDU: Commercial banks listed on the Nepal Stock Exchange (NEPSE) have begun announcing dividends for their shareholders from the profit of fiscal year 2081/82. Out of the 19 listed commercial banks, 11 have announced their dividend proposals so far.
Among the banks that have declared dividends, Everest Bank has proposed the highest payout, announcing a 20% dividend, which includes 6% bonus shares and 14% cash dividend.
Dividend Breakdown by Banks
Everest Bank: 6% bonus + 14% cash = 20%
Siddhartha Bank: 5% bonus + 5.53% cash = 10.53%
Laxmi Sunrise Bank: 10% bonus + 0.53% cash = 10.53%
Standard Chartered Bank Nepal: 19% cash dividend
Agricultural Development Bank (ADB/N): 3.25% bonus + 9.75% cash = 13%
Sanima Bank: 7.37% cash dividend
Citizens Bank: 5% bonus + 0.26% cash = 5.26%
NMB Bank: 5% bonus + 5% cash = 10%
Nepal SBI Bank: 4% bonus + 5% cash = 9%
Global IME Bank: 8% cash dividend
Machhapuchchhre Bank: 4% bonus + 4% cash = 8%
Banks Yet to Announce Dividends
Seven commercial banks have not declared dividends yet. These include:
Nabil Bank
Prabhu Bank
Himalayan Bank
Nepal Bank
NIC Asia Bank
Nepal Investment Mega Bank
Prime Commercial Bank
Meanwhile, Kumari Bank has decided not to distribute any dividend this year, leaving its shareholders empty-handed.
